Marieke Hardy explores living eulogies; the team riff ideas around lost and stolen and returned objects; foodie Michael Harden espouses the loveliness of ugly vegetables; Simone Ubaldi reviews 'Honey Boy'; marine biologist Ricky-Lee Erickson talks about seahorses; and Nat Harris muses on the magic of panpipes. With presenters Sarah Smith, Geraldine Hickey, and fill-in presenters Daniel James and Nat Harris.
